PreGame Press Conference vs Colorado
Reporter 1: Coach Javelina, how do you feel about your team coming into this game versus Colorado??
Coach Javelina: Well we played a tough team in Auburn last week where our defense had to step up a little more. Our quarterback is a 1st year starter and he is still getting the jitters out. I feel very strong about my defense coming into this game. I just need a little more production out of my offensive line and quarterback.
Reporter 2: Well Roken Flo lost a close game to Bearfan's UCLA Bruins team last week. What do you think this game will be determined by??
Coach Javelina: We have played Roken in previous years and we are familiar with his style of play. Turnovers are the key to the game. The team that has the fewest turnovers will most likely come out on top. Roken is a very good coach and is working with alot over there in Boulder. I think it will be a great game.
Reporter 3: Well you speak about your quarterback play. Is there any thought about taking Travis Lane from his redshirt??
Coach Javelina: Well we have thought about it but we feel that Brown will give us the best chance to win at this point and time. Travis is still learning the system and he is poised for greatness. But we feel Brown puts us in the best position at this moment and time.
